MSc Sport Management is designed to give you the skills and expertise you need to compete in the sport industry and related businesses and organisations, by combining specialist teaching about the principles and practice of sport management with general training in management, business organisation, strategy and research methods.

It covers several key areas, such as sport event management, sport economics and sport competition design, sport marketing, governance and regulatory issues, with emphasis on the wider sport sector. It will help you to develop a deeper understanding of management, governance and regulatory issues within the business of sport.
The course is ideally suited to the needs of executives within a variety of sport organisations, such as professional sport clubs, governing bodies, media organisations and sport-related businesses. It is also ideal for members of supporters’ organisations, local government officials with responsibilities in the leisure field, and people with a general interest in the sport and media industries.
It is relevant for anyone seeking a broad general education in sport management with a view to switching career into the sport business sector.
